How On-Site Nitrogen & Gas Systems Enhance Freshness

Among the most effective solutions for preserving product quality are On-Site Nitrogen & Gas Systems for Food & Beverage Industry. These systems utilize nitrogen to create an inert atmosphere, slowing the oxidation process that can lead to spoilage. By replacing oxygen in storage and packaging environments, nitrogen helps keep beverages fresh for a more extended period, allowing companies to reduce waste significantly.

Advantages of Using Nitrogen in Beverage Storage

One of the main benefits of incorporating On-Site Nitrogen & Gas Systems is the reduction of chemical reactions that degrade product quality. Oxidation not only affects taste but can also compromise color and nutritional value. By using nitrogen, manufacturers can effectively minimize these risks, maintaining the product's original characteristics for longer durations.
